Why Live in Kay-Catherine
Kay-Catherine in Newport is a historic neighborhood known for its Victorian, Colonial, and Greek Revival homes, many designed by renowned architects like Richard Morris Hunt and the McKim Mead & White firm. The area, once a summer retreat for writers and socialites, is now a sought-after residential enclave. Homes here sit on larger lots with sidewalks shaded by Black Cherry and Red Maple trees, and some old mansions have been converted into multi-family units. The neighborhood's walkability is a key feature, with downtown Newport and Bellevue Avenue's shops just a 10 to 15-minute walk away. Residents enjoy proximity to the water, fostering a strong sailing community, and can easily visit Easton Beach, known locally as First Beach, which offers soft sand, food trucks, and a playground. Although there are no parks within Kay-Catherine, Braga Park is a short 3-mile drive away, providing open fields, a basketball court, and a small baseball field. The Cliff Walk, a 3.5-mile coastal hiking path, is also nearby. The Newport News Public School District serves the area, with Pell Elementary, Frank E. Thompson Middle School, and Rogers High School, which is noted for its JROTC program. Public transportation is available through the Rhode Island Transportation Authority, and the TF Green Rhode Island International Airport is 26 miles away via Route 138. For daily needs, residents shop at Shaw's supermarket or local convenience stores like Leo's Market. The dining scene is vibrant, with popular spots like the Black Pearl and Clarke Cookhouse offering coastal views and fresh seafood.
Home Trends in Kay-Catherine, RI
On average, homes in Kay-Catherine, Newport sell after 53 days on the market compared to the national average of 70 days. The median sale price for homes in Kay-Catherine, Newport over the last 12 months is $390,000, up 73%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
